Transaction 32c91cf13f50021c9936e55b50ac9084dd1a49a836e23368747fe65c34f25ccc

7 Input
2 Outputs
  • 32c91cf13f50021c9936e55b50ac9084dd1a49a836e23368747fe65c34f25ccc:0
  • value  52301
    address  1CukKFjNGRQC4dovseDkMLfDZerwoBu5jL
  • 32c91cf13f50021c9936e55b50ac9084dd1a49a836e23368747fe65c34f25ccc:1
  • value  5000000
    address  3Cqoa8wNK2PgCMuapL18KtpU9WiYEpJe9G